XC40 tyres - any reviews?
Hi guys picked up our used XC40 FE D4 this morning, but needing a couple of front tyres.
Car is currently sitting on Continental PremiumContact 6 from factory and managed 10,700 miles, but now on the limit on the front, around 4.5mm on the rears. This is on 235/50/19 99V R-Design wheels. Looking for reviews if anybody has experience of other tyres please. Current considerations include: - Conti’s again - if it’s good enough for Volvo.... (£148) - Pirelli Scorpion Verde Seal Inside - factory fit on my XC90 (£130 each) - Michelin CrossClimate - as I have on my daughter’s car and am impressed. (£184 each) I know the mileage I should expect from the Cont’s, but any comments gratefully received. |

I've got Pirelli Scorpion Verde All Seasons tyres fitted to my XC40'
The car was new In May of this year and came supplied with summer tyres - don't remember the brand. I part exchanged the summer tyres for the Pirelli all seasons ones. Never really understood why they supply 4wd cars with summer tyres, especially up here in the Highlands. I had the Pirelli tyres on my previous Volvo and was very pleased with them. Comfortable ride, low noise and good grip in difficult conditions. The wear rate was also very good. |

My XC40 came with Michelin Primacy 4 (Volvo fitment). I'm happy with them. Apparently the 'Volvo fitment' means the design has been tweaked to give a (very) small percentage specifc-to-volvo improvement in fuel consumtion or noise or some such. Is it worth it? - How can I tell?
